Subtitle: When Does Ejaculation Stop for Men?

Ejaculation is a process that occurs in men during sexual arousal and is associated with orgasm. It is the release of semen from the penis, which contains sperm and other fluids. As men age, their bodies go through several changes, including changes to their ejaculatory abilities. So, the question remains: at what age does a man stop ejaculating?

The answer is not straightforward, as there is no one definitive age at which ejaculation stops. Factors such as health, lifestyle, and genetics all play a role in when ejaculation stops for men. Generally, ejaculation will start to decrease in frequency as men age, but some men may still be able to ejaculate well into their older years.

Testosterone is the primary male sex hormone and plays a major role in male sexual development and function. As men age, their testosterone levels gradually decline, which can lead to a decrease in ejaculatory function.

Health Conditions can also affect when ejaculation stops for men. Certain medical conditions, such as di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and prostate cancer, can interfere with ejaculation. In addition, certain medications can also interfere with ejaculation.

Lifestyle Habits can also affect when ejaculation stops for men. Smoking, excessive alcohol consumption, and drug use can all interfere with ejaculation. In addition, stress and anxiety can also interfere with ejaculation.

There is no definitive answer to this question as it varies greatly depending on the individual. Generally speaking, men can continue to ejaculate and have sex until old age. However, as men age, they may experience decreased semen volume or a decrease in the force of ejaculation. Additionally, men may find that they take longer to become aroused and experience fewer and weaker orgasms. While ejaculation may not cease altogether, it may become less frequent or less satisfying. Therefore, it is important to speak to a doctor if you have any concerns or questions about age-related changes in ejaculation.
